School of Law: LLB/LP Honours
The method of obtaining an LLB or LLB/LP with Honours is a little different to most other degree programmes in the University. As in other Australian law schools, there is no additional "Honours year". Instead, Honours are awarded simply on the basis of overall performance in the law degree - although students have the option, if they so desire, of completing a major research assignment (a 10,000 word paper).
The topic LLAW 4042A Legal Research Paper will be available for semester 1 or semester 2 commencement.
